What’s In My E-Liquid?
It is important to understand how the components of the best e-liquid work to produce that tasty vapour, and all vape liquids consist of the four same materials; they each have an impact on the type of vapour produced; they are –
- Propylene Glycol is an organic food additive that is a great carrier of flavour; also used in medicines, it is a thinner liquid used in both industries for over 60 years.
- Vegetable Glycerin – is a clear liquid with a thicker consistency produced from plant oils such as coconut or soy; it is used in foods and cosmetics. E-liquids with a high VG content produce large vapour clouds and a smooth vape.
- Nicotine – the nicotine in vape juice will be either the more traditional Freebase nicotine or, the newer Nic salt. The more modern option produces an excellent smooth vape.
- Food-Based Flavourings are the standard food industry flavours that give countless products their distinctive tastes.

The Different Vape Mixtures
Without knowing it, most vapers will use an e-liquid with an even 50/50 PG/VG mix; this is a great all-rounder that gives a superb vape suitable for all, especially the newer vaper looking for the sensation of smoking cigarettes. Two other pre-mixed e-liquids lean towards a more specific way of vaping; they are –
- 70/30 – this e-liquid has a 70%VG/30%PG mix; it is designed for use in sub-ohm vape devices that burn the thicker liquid at a lower resistance. The outcome is a super smooth vape that produces enormous clouds of vapour.
- 80/20 – as its direct opposite, this is mixed to an 80%PG/20%VG formula. It gives a vape higher in flavour and delivers a throat hit suited to newer vapers, best used in starter devices, vape pens or pods.
